Sitting down for tea JLP01_08_045157

JOHN LAING AND SON LIMITED, PAGE STREET, MILL HILL, BARNET, GREATER LONDON. Children seated for tea at a Christmas party.
This Christmas party was held for the children of Laing staff who worked at the Mill Hill office
